My teaching experience involves various roles at the University of Ghana Business School from 2018 to 2021 as a teaching and graduate assistant. With a business administration-centered educational background, I taught undergraduate-level courses on Social Responsibility and Ethics and Electronic Business, and Master level courses on Services Marketing. I also supervised students in carrying out dissertations and research projects. My teaching style focuses on engaging students through a combination of theoretical and practical examples which help in grounding studies being carried out. I believe practical examples are good ways to get students engaged and informed about a subject being addressed. As such I believe in engaging students in research projects which helps them explore more into issues they primarily would not have. I also believe that students are unique in their own way and the teacher must learn to find a balance on how to keep his students engaged in the subject by identifying what drives them.
